Tor Browser 4.0.3 is released
A new release for the stable Tor Browser is available from the Tor Browser Project page and also from our distribution directory.
Tor Browser 4.0.3 is based on Firefox ESR 31.4.0, which features important security updates to Firefox. Additionally, it contains updates to meek, NoScript and Tor Launcher.
Here is the changelog since 4.0.2:
- All Platforms
- Update Firefox to 31.4.0esr
- Update NoScript to 2.6.9.10
- Update meek to 0.15
- Update Tor Launcher to 0.2.7.0.2
- Translation updates only

Well, you can deactivate RC 4.
Type in the address bar of firefox
about:config
then search for "RC 4" or "RC4"
then deactivate all entries listed, so switch from "true" to "false"
that's it ! :)
